Class-beating resale value: Mazda CX-30 crowned 2021 Wertmeister

Comunicato Stampa disponibile solo in lingua originale. 

  • The #mazda #cx30 depreciates least among subcompact SUVs sold in Germany
  • AUTO BILD and Schwacke honour 13 models in 18th edition of the annual competition

The #mazda #cx30 has added to a growing list of accolades after being named “Wertmeister 2021” (2021 Residual Value Champion) by German fortnightly magazine #auto BILD and independent #automotive pricing specialist Schwacke. They determined that the #cx30 e-Skyactiv G 2.0 M Hybrid* holds its value better than any other B-SUV available in Germany.

“We’re delighted that the #cx30 is proving to be such an all-around-talent,” remarked Bernhard Kaplan, managing director of #mazda Motors Deutschland (Mazda Germany). “The Wertmeister label is solid proof of the quality and appeal of the #mazda brand.”

Residual value were calculated based on a four-year period with annual mileage of 15,000km. The results reflect Schwake’s passenger car market experience as well as general economic developments, a changing regulatory environment and operating costs. #auto BILD and Schwacke chose their Residual Value Champions this year for the 18th time, recognising models in 13 categories. The #cx30 finished in its segment ahead of the Opel Mokka and Ford Puma.

It’s another honour for the popular model launched in 2019, having taken home a 2019 Golden Steering Wheel for automobile innovation as well as numerous design awards around the world including the 2020-2021 Car Design of the Year award from the Japan Automobile Hall of Fame.

The #cx30 was also Thailand Car of the Year 2020, Consumer Reports’ Top Pick in the U.S., and a finalist for 2020 World Car of the Year (alongside the Mazda3). It received the maximum five-star safety rating from Euro NCAP. 

* Combined NEDC fuel consumption: 6.0-5.1l/100 km; CO₂ emissions: 136-116g/km
